Description

A Morse Taper Shank drill incorporates a standardized taper shank design that is used in tapered drill chucks. The Morse Taper was invented by Stephen A. Morse (also the inventor of the twist drill) in the mid-1860s. Morse Tapers come in eight sizes identified by number between 0 and 7. Often this is abbreviated as MT followed by a digit, for example a Morse taper number 4 would be MT4. The MT2 taper is the size most often found in drill presses up to 1/2'' capacity.
